Associate, Structured Finance

ConnectGen
Houston, TX, United States
Full-time

ConnectGen is looking for an Associate, Structured Finance to support capital raise activities for utility scale wind, solar and energy storage projects, and portfolios.

The structured finance team leads origination, structuring, negotiation, and execution of third-party financings, including tax equity partnerships, tax credit monetization and project finance debt.

The structured finance team plays a key role in securing competitive financing for our projects and supporting ConnectGen's goals of increasing renewable power generation capacity.

This position follows a hybrid work schedule of three days per week in the office located downtown Houston and two days remote.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Support the origination, structuring, negotiation and execution of tax equity / tax credit financings, structured finance (construction finance, back leverage) and asset rotation transactions.
  • Develop and maintain financial models used in financing transactions and internal analysis. Analyze and recommend structuring considerations and financing alternatives.
  • Prepare marketing presentations (teasers, CIMs) and support outreach and selection of financing partners.
  • Coordinate various due diligence processes with internal departments (development, construction, operations, finance). Manage external stakeholders such as financial advisors, legal counsel and consultants while managing project data rooms.
  • Provide support to the investment approval process by providing financing and structuring guidance to M&A, tax, and accounting teams.
  • Support corporate finance activities including managing letters of credit issuances.
  • Develop and maintain strong relationships with internal departments to ensure accurate information is provided to lenders and / or investors.
  • Review commercial agreements (PPAs, leases, etc.) to ensure compatibility with financing requirements; provide relevant feedback to commercial teams.
  • Maintain relationships with financial institutions including banks, export credit agencies, institutional investors, private equity / infrastructure funds, IPPs and utilities.
  • Monitor industry trends, competitor activities, and emerging financing structures in renewable energy to inform decision-making and optimize financing strategies.
